The Impact of AI on Amazon’s Corporate Workforce: Reshaping Roles for Efficiency and Customer Experience

In a recent announcement, Amazon CEO Andy Jassy revealed the company’s strategic plan to leverage generative AI and agents, a move that is set to transform the landscape of its corporate workforce. The integration of artificial intelligence is poised to streamline operations by automating routine tasks, ultimately leading to a potential reduction in the number of employees in corporate roles within the organization. While this development may raise concerns about job security and the future of work, experts suggest that the shift towards AI is more likely to result in a reshuffling of the workforce rather than mass unemployment.
